Output 3fb9f26429e88633198fd806cac7058ede1158d577af9b9c88d7fab315bc851d:6

value
1008802
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d92b25f907e6a024dc764c987b01d3cc8973fde OP_EQUAL
address
34PPFn2beALi2ve3g9qbBsmztiGjv7ES2W
transaction
3fb9f26429e88633198fd806cac7058ede1158d577af9b9c88d7fab315bc851d
spent
true